    I’m 33 weeks and just got back from a 10 hour car trip last night and it was tough. I made up a bed (camping pad and sleeping bag, 4 pillows) in the back of the car and I slept there when I got too uncomfortable. While sitting in the seat, I sat with my legs crossed, which helped my back some. Also drink lots of water, you’ll be stopping anwyway with your bladder, so that covers the walking.

    On the first leg of my trip I stopped every hour and I wasn’t in as much pain as by the end as yesterday when we stopped every 2-3 hours for the return trip. I’m still recovering today from this trip, my back is killing me.

    Also, make sure you have medical forms on you in case you have any problems on the road/ out of town.
